a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ndrew Walbran <qwandor@google.com>2023-10-18 19:48:35 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2023-10-18 19:48:35 +0000
commit725a95f5e73c0d9217407e51dab7037d6f8aa1ee (patch)
tree70a44b234f242e52091481c2f6c2777f6e3b615e
parent532137c55082567f2ff4d634713a81b7a4f7356b (diff)
parenta8a0d8413a2c738346ad48739d6abf8104f70c6d (diff)
downloadargh-725a95f5e73c0d9217407e51dab7037d6f8aa1ee.tar.gz
Migrate to cargo_embargo. am: 7a86dff6c4 am: ec28b6da8b am: a8a0d8413a
Original change: https://android-review.googlesource.com/c/platform/external/rust/crates/argh/+/2796293 Change-Id: Ic02a51698a42f4ddee525c94b0bccc5262c4dff6 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
-rw-r--r--Android.bp8
-rw-r--r--cargo2android.json15
-rw-r--r--cargo_embargo.json17
3 files changed, 20 insertions, 20 deletions
diff --git a/Android.bp b/Android.bp
index 029b44a..21682b8 100644
--- a/Android.bp
+++ b/Android.bp
@@ -1,4 +1,4 @@
-// This file is generated by cargo2android.py --config cargo2android.json.
+// This file is generated by cargo_embargo.
// Do not modify this file as changes will be overridden on upgrade.
package {
@@ -41,7 +41,7 @@ rust_test {
rust_test {
name: "argh_test_tests_lib",
host_supported: true,
- crate_name: "argh",
+ crate_name: "lib",
cargo_env_compat: true,
cargo_pkg_version: "0.1.10",
srcs: ["tests/lib.rs"],
@@ -67,9 +67,7 @@ rust_library {
cargo_pkg_version: "0.1.10",
srcs: ["src/lib.rs"],
edition: "2018",
- rustlibs: [
- "libargh_shared",
- ],
+ rustlibs: ["libargh_shared"],
proc_macros: ["libargh_derive"],
apex_available: [
"//apex_available:platform",
diff --git a/cargo2android.json b/cargo2android.json
deleted file mode 100644
index 1dd19e7..0000000
--- a/cargo2android.json
+++ /dev/null
@@ -1,15 +0,0 @@
-{
- "apex-available": [
- "//apex_available:platform",
- "com.android.virt"
- ],
- "device": true,
- "run": true,
- "tests": true,
- "dependency-blocklist": [
- "trybuild"
- ],
- "test-blocklist": [
- "tests/compiletest.rs"
- ]
-}
diff --git a/cargo_embargo.json b/cargo_embargo.json
new file mode 100644
index 0000000..51eae9d
--- /dev/null
+++ b/cargo_embargo.json
@@ -0,0 +1,17 @@
+{
+ "tests": true,
+ "apex_available": [
+ "//apex_available:platform",
+ "com.android.virt"
+ ],
+ "package": {
+ "argh": {
+ "dep_blocklist": [
+ "libtrybuild"
+ ]
+ }
+ },
+ "module_blocklist": [
+ "argh_test_tests_compiletest"
+ ]
+}